2017年12月26日

摘要: 关于autoit的使用,发现了一个新的问题。同一个autoit脚本,并不能完全在不同的浏览器复用。比如下边这个页面,从页面风格上就能看出来,同一个页面,在IE和chrome下,差别还是很大的。 autoit对于在不同浏览器中打开的windows文件上传控件识别的结果也是不同的。 在IE下识别的结果: 阅读全文
posted @ 2017-12-26 19:52 _小菜鸟 阅读(262) 评论(0) 推荐(0) 编辑

2017年12月25日

摘要: 看虫师的基于python的selenium自动化测试一书,发现其中有个错误的地方。 书中给出的例子脚本内容: 选择的文件目录,不能用反斜杠进行转义,否则windows控件会报识别不了文件的错误。另外对于这个脚本,还有点疑问,为什么等待窗口的出现,要放在选择文件后面呢。我把前面两句调换了下顺序,先等待 阅读全文
posted @ 2017-12-25 17:52 _小菜鸟 阅读(77) 评论(0) 推荐(0) 编辑

2017年12月19日

摘要: 不小心踩了python的一个小坑,导致我看一个程序,看了好久都没想明白,后来自己亲自试了下,才发现,原来range()这个函数,有点玄机。 看网上介绍它的时候,基本解释都是这样的 然后,就想当然的以为 range(0,-1) 表示只有一个元素的列表[0]。然后去看关于打印三角形的代码,就绕进去了。 阅读全文
posted @ 2017-12-19 20:00 _小菜鸟 阅读(149) 评论(0) 推荐(0) 编辑

2017年8月22日

摘要: 1.MD5在线加密工具 http://md5jiami.51240.com/ 2.json穿格式化工具 http://www.bejson.com/ 点击校验按钮,进行校验和格式化 经过校验的json,格式比之前工整多了 此处为json校验结果 如果json存在错误,此处会有提示 阅读全文
posted @ 2017-08-22 13:48 _小菜鸟 阅读(115) 评论(0) 推荐(0) 编辑

2017年8月21日

摘要: 1.启动jmeter 4. 2.新建测试计划 3.添加 要启动的线程数,总启动时间以及循环次数 4.线程组 右键 选择 HTTP信息头管理器 5.选择线程组 右键 ,添加http请求,填写发送请求的服务器ip、端口、地址以及报文 6.将webservice接口中的值添加到测试计划的http信息头管理 阅读全文
posted @ 2017-08-21 16:22 _小菜鸟 阅读(300) 评论(0) 推荐(0) 编辑
摘要: 准备环境: win10 jmeter安装包 jdk 一、jmeter下载 网址: http://jmeter.apache.org/download_jmeter.cgi 根据自己的需要下载安装包。目前官网的版本是3.1,需要的jdk版本要在1.7以上。 提示:下载软件时,推荐用360浏览器,IE和 阅读全文
posted @ 2017-08-21 16:15 _小菜鸟 阅读(1991) 评论(0) 推荐(0) 编辑
摘要: 用windows平台测试时,会受到网络条件的影响,导致测试结果不够准确,尤其是高并发的情况下,需要能够精准的测试请求的响应时长,对于网络的要求更加苛刻。在这样的情况下,可以考虑在linux服务器端安装jmeter进行测试。 下面就简要介绍下linux环境安装jmeter的步骤。 准备环境: linu 阅读全文
posted @ 2017-08-21 16:12 _小菜鸟 阅读(8489) 评论(0) 推荐(0) 编辑

2016年6月3日

摘要: 存储过程的基本结构: CREATE OR REPLACE PROCEDURE 存储过程名称(参数1 类型1,参数2 类型2.....) AS(或者IS) 变量、常量定义; BEGIN 代码; END; 例:向T_STUDENT表添加学生学号,学号为SAAAA~SBBBB,其中,AAAA和BBBB是在 阅读全文
posted @ 2016-06-03 10:27 _小菜鸟 阅读(248) 评论(0) 推荐(0) 编辑

2016年5月29日

摘要: 一、数据库死锁的现象 程序在执行的过程中,点击确定或保存按钮,程序没有响应,也没有出现报错。 二、死锁的原理 当对于数据库某个表的某一列做更新或删除等操作,执行完毕后该条语句不提 交,另一条对于这一列数据做更新操作的语句在执行的时候就会处于等待状态, 此时的现象是这条语句一直在执行,但一直没有执行成 阅读全文
posted @ 2016-05-29 10:12 _小菜鸟 阅读(217) 评论(0) 推荐(0) 编辑

导航